Gold Investment Basics: How to Purchase Gold Effectively

Embarking on your precious metals investment path can be both enticing, but it's essential to find the most suitable way to purchase this precious asset. Understanding the various investment avenues is crucial for making informed selections.

  • Gold bullion offers a concrete investment, allowing you to hold actual physical gold.
  • Securities Tracking Gold Prices provide a convenient way to invest in the price of gold without purchasing physical metal.
  • Shares of Gold Producers allow you to gain from the prosperity of companies involved in mining gold.

Despite your preferred investment strategy, it's crucial to conduct thorough research before allocating any capital. Seeking advice from a experienced professional can also provide essential knowledge to help you navigate the complexities of gold acquisition.
